I have a block of 4 of 229 - 2 are MNH and 2 are MLH - but according to Scott 1 NH is $2,250 and 1 MH one is $450 so the total is over 5K but a block of 4 is 2K ? Yes I know my stamps are not well centered. I am just wondering why a block of 4 has a less CV then 1 MNH one?

They are valuing a block of 4 with all 4 stamps hinged - 4 singles would be 1800 and the block is 2000, so it is valued higher

Siegel would probably value the block as singles. Two at the MNH cv and two at the hinged cv for a total of $5400. They do it all of the time. Whatever shows a bigger Scott $$$ number.
